Obi-Wan Kenobi has turned out to be a pretty big success for Disney. A new tweet that was shared on the official Disney+ account today can confirm that Lucasfilm’s new series centered around Ewan McGregor’s titular Jedi Knight managed to score the biggest opening weekend yet for an original series on the mouse’s service based on hours streamed, beating out the premieres of other popular shows that presumably include The Mandalorian and WandaVision. Obi-Wan Kenobi is unique in that Lucasfilm and Disney decided to launch the show with not one, but two episodes for its premiere this past Friday, May 27, following a two-day delay from its originally intended release date. The third episode of Obi-Wan Kenobi will begin streaming tomorrow on Disney+.

Obi-Wan Kenobi, the new limited series set between the events of Star Wars: Revenge of the Sith and Star Wars: A New Hope, has arrived on Disney+! With a promise to reunite Kenobi with the Sith Lord Darth Vader, and introducing Vader’s Inquisitorius into live action, fans are in for a thrilling story. The first two episodes are now streaming, with subsequent installments of the six-episode season premiering every Wednesday in June.

Obi-Wan Kenobi, a Jedi Master’s untold story, stars Ewan McGregor reprising the role as the titular Kenobi, along with Hayden Christensen as Darth Vader. Joining the cast are Moses Ingram as Reva, Joel Edgerton as Owen Lars, Bonnie Piesse as Beru Lars, Kumail Nanjiani, Indira Varma, Rupert Friend, O’Shea Jackson Jr., Sung Kang, Simone Kessell, and Benny Safdie.
